ASCD (Agillence Supply Chain Designer)
ASCD is a supply chain design tool, especially powerful where your business requires multi-stop shipments. It optimizes simultaneously multi-stop route territory (outbound from warehouses) and upper echelon supply chain together.
Challenges
ASCD is a tool to design supply chain network optimizing several cost factors while respecting various constraints such as capacities. A simple example, but challenging as shown in the picture above, is to trade off inbound costs, warehousing/inventory carrying costs at DC's and outbound costs where outbound involves multi-stop routes with delivery frequency requirements. To have an implementable solution, it is essential to model multi-stop delivery cost accurately considering delivery frequency requirements.
